考博听力中的影响理解的词组汇集

1) a big time:尽兴,高兴的时刻 i7 $4i|  
e.g. I had a big time there. ,LI$=lJ@  
the big time:第一流,最高级 paKur%2u  
e.g. Don’t worry you are in the big time now. kY>jp@w V  
2) according to:按照,根据 U*sjv6*T  
e.g. They were commended or criticized according to their work. `HVS}}{a  
according as:随……而定 :j(e+A1@  
e.g. The thermometer rises or falls according as the air is hot or cold. 9mE6Cp.Wv  
3) admit to:承认 Lk%`hsv  
e.g. I have to admit to a dislike for modern music. &T.d"i  
admit sb.(in) to:允许某人进入某地或加入某组织、行业 MB7UI8  
e.g. They have admitted me into their club. uqz HS>GM  
4) all for:完全赞成 /q| r!+  
e.g. I am all for holding a meeting to discuss it. x,wXR=H  
for all:尽管 D;nd _{%  
e.g. They could not open the box for all their forces. k1lo{jw`  
5) all in all:总的说来 EdL2t``  
e.g. All in all it is a success. Zv]'9,cbk  
all in:疲倦,筋疲力尽 oW}nr<G{<  
e.g. He was all in but he stuck it out. mM9aT0_w  
6) as it is (was):照目前的情况来看 2[!3!@.  
e.g. As it is we shall be able to complete our task in time. #ovausK[7

as it were:可以说,姑且这样说 # &,W x  
e.g. He is as it were a walking dictionary. #B!| sXC  
7) as much as:几乎,实际上 - -fRhN>  
e.g. By running away he as much as admitted that he had taken the money. !hs33@*u~  
as much…as:与……一样多 e{EC# %x_  
e.g. It is as much our responsibility as yours. V` T l$EF  
8) as well:也,还是……为好 /0Jf/-}ovn  
e.g. He gave me advice and money as well. Since you have begun to do it you may as well finish it. Y/x>wNW  
as well as:不仅……而且,除……之外 ~dO+kD  
e.g. With television we see a picture as well as hearing sound. Small towns as well as big cities are being ^ h$^j  
rapidly industrialized. O~Jm<  
9) at one time 从前某个时期 v9\U2j  
e.g. At one time we met frequently. 4wMZNa<Sx  
at a time:每次,一次 z''ejq  
e.g. You can borrow only two books at a time. q+znb'i-x  
10) attach to:属于,归因于 XS}-@5TI  
e.g. No blame attaches to him. C'y4 ~7  
attach oneself to:参加,加入 T@Bu Fr`]<  
e.g. He attached himself to the group of climbers. ?8w5tfN6t  
11) be a credit to:为……增光 cP",szcY  
e.g. I hope you will be a credit to your school. KE4#vKV0yC  
do credit to:为……增进荣誉 *@{  
e.g. This piece of work does credit to you. EI9;J-c  
12) bear in mind:记住 <NEz{1Z

e.g. I hope you will bear in mind all I am saying. J(G-c5&=  
have in mind:考虑 <vE|QxpR  
e.g. Don’t give your confidence to others regarding the plan you have in mind. Z2L7US -  
13) begin with:以……为起点 ~?4 BP%g-y  
e.g. He advised me to begin with something easy. r$1b=m,0d  
to begin with:首先 C2aA])7 D  
e.g. To begin with we must consider the problem from all sides. p+pu_T;~  
14) build up:逐步建成,增强 `W>Sss  
e.g. They are trying hard to build up an independent economy. He went for an ocean voyage and built up !{4'=+  
his health. pw&k0?K#  
build on:以……为基础,依赖 Kx?.g#>U;  
e.g. Let’s build on your idea. We shall build on your supporting us. (j~T7og  
15) by day:在白天 '`YZJ  
e.g. Most of them work by day and study by night. ^9`|QF  
by the day:(指工作报酬等)按日计算 `M*jrkM]x  
e.g. Will you pay me by the day or by the hour? Dpwqg3,  
16) can but 只好……罢了 0K6My4d{  
e.g. We can but try to make him see how unreasonable he has been. Q_Br{ `c  
cannot but:不得不,禁不住 =W;e9 6#  
e.g. I cannot but tell her the truth.(=I cannot help telling her the truth) :.tL~% q  
17) come forth:出现,发行 ,>01Cs=t8  
e.g. Many new things are coming forth.. Do you know that a set of new stamps has come forth? h-//v~V)  
come forward:自告奋勇,提出供讨论 $bD`B'5  
c:52pYf+  
They have come forward with an offer to help. The matter was deferred at last evening’s meeting but will {/(.Bpld  
come forward at our next session. xFekSH7[F  
18) compare … to 比拟(指出其中的相似点) IBvn q8\  
e.g. Man’s life is often compared to a candle. 3A{)C_1a  
compare … with:把……和……相比(指出其不同之处) BsA'r+ho?H  
e.g. He compared his camera with mine. E]8uj8K3]  
19) consist in:包含在……中 yf;TIh%)=  
e.g. Happiness consists in good health. |AacV  
consist of:由……组成 NM^uP+uS  
e.g. The apartment consisted of two rooms and a kitchen. vBJxhK-  
20) end on:两端相碰,正对 7R7+jL,  
e.g. The two ships collided each other end on. We shouldn’t place the bicycles end on. O_ZYm{T[7  
on end:竖着,连续地,不断地 ?;_>BX|Zjl  
e.g. Place the box on end. She often works for 20 hours on end "OA{[)fw"  
21) familiar to:某事为某人熟知 zfE8=d8U  
e.g. There were facts not familiar to me.  BdiV  
familiar with:熟悉或通晓某事 \K~wsu/?`  
e.g. He is familiar with English German and French.. wPm  
22)feel for sb.:同情某人,为某人难过 (hdu+^Qj=  
e.g. I feel for you in your sorrow. e8T"d%f?  
feel for sth:(用手、脚、棍子等)摸索,寻找某物 GB^`A  
e.g. She felt under the pillow for her watch. :F@Uq<~(  
23)for a moment:片刻,一会儿 nT}Wx/ aT  
G'p322Bu  
e.g. She was silent for a moment weighing in her mind the pros and cons. |dbKK\ X9  
for the moment:此刻、暂时 n}[S  
e.g. I cannot recall his name for the moment. Dw7Xy}I/  
24)get down:下去,下来;写下来 Q K#wsw  
e.g. The bus was so jammed that I could not get down. Here’s the telephone number I got down for you. L'S,=NYXY  
get down to:认真着手进行处理  7n.Oem  
e.g. It is no good shirking the job it will have to be got down to. ~Gz9pBv1  
25)get into trouble with sb.:遭到某人的(训斥等) ZAU#^bEQB  
e.g. Poor Tom is always getting into trouble with the boss. @v ^j<B  
get sb. into trouble:使某人陷入困境 G"E_4YkJ  
e.g. The letter got me into trouble. P_N F;v5 v  
26)give sb. a hand:帮助某人或参与某人做某事 (YYg-@IO  
e.g. Give me a hand with the cleaning please. ] uyp i#[  
give sb. one’s hand:与某人握手 Xpn\TD<_I  
e.g. She gave me her hand and wished me a good trip ,!@MLn  
27)go through:检查,搜查;通过,穿过 $C5*@`GM$  
e.g. They went through our luggage at the customs. It took us a whole week to go through the great forest. Y 0Fq -H  
go through with:把……坚持到底 sH;_U)ssH  
e.g. We should go through with the experiment now we’ve started. vi UJ4Pn  
28) good for:有益于 Z:7eroZP  
e.g. This book is good for your English study. >@Ht*h{~  
for good:永久地 5!fYTo|G>  
e.g. The lost money was gone for good. V0_tk"  
irD5;xk([  
29)have a fancy for:爱好,喜爱 e 9RYk:O  
e.g. She has a fancy for nice clothes. QwWd"Of  
have a fancy that:猜想,认为 ed#fDMXGQ%  
e.g. I have a fancy that he will come tonight. O_a^|ln&  
30)head up:领头;领导 :R=6Ku>  
e.g. A band headed up the parade. Mr. Jones will head up the new business. ;[R6rV He{  
heads up:注意,小心 X:g5;NT  
e.g. Heads up now You can do better than that. ./k7""4   
31)in a way:在某种程度上 {<gv1Yht  
e.g. In a way it is an important book. <n]PD;.4  
in the way:妨碍,挡路 k Alx m{  
I will visit you next weekend if there is nothing in the way. [QgP6f]=  
32)in black:穿黑色衣服 G]f |?  
e.g. Arabian women are always dressed in black clothes. X'PZCg W  
in the black:赢利,赚钱 "4\  
New production methods put the company in the black. { sC Ni  
33) in charge of:负责 196a~xNV  
e.g. Who is in charge of this work? ==m[t- 9x  
in the charge of:照护 F5 ]<=i  
e.g. The patients are in the charge of the nurse. } jJKE  
34) in hand:控制 [A84R04_%  
e.g. There was a little rioting but the police soon had the situation in hand. *7h~0%WR  
@}d;-m~  
hand in:递交,交给 b`#YJpA  
e.g. He handed in his resignation in protest against it. js81@WX!c  
35) in one’s honor:向……表示敬意或感谢 hXjZ>n``  
e.g. The day was kept as a holiday in honor of victory. BeVDTk :  
on one’s honor:用人格担保 kPs?  
e.g. We were on our honor not to cheat on the exam. /#Aw7F$Ey  
36) in possession of:占有 V )<>W_g  
e.g. He is in possession of this house. JKM(fX+  
in the possession of:被占有 cWkg.ri-x  
e.g. The keys are in the possession of the door keeper. fI)XV7,X  
37)in spirit:在内心,在精神上 O0#[hY,  
e.g. In spirit at least these laws were very fair. }MRgNr'k  
in spirits:情绪或心情(好、坏等) Qt+D ,X  
e.g. He is in poor spirits because of his failing in the exam. dRron_'  
38)keep up:继续,保持 hUlRtt  
e.g. They entered into a correspondence which was kept up for almost ten years. c6xr[tc%  
keep up with:与……齐步前进,跟上 Og7yT{h_  
e.g. With their help he has kept up with the class.  <J;O$S  
39)look about:环视 OCx'cSs-=  
e.g. He looked about him with great interest. VAL? Z  
look about for:四处寻找 6LDZ|K@  
e.g. She was looking about for the key she had just lost. iP(MDVg  
40)look up:向上看 h.vy SwF"j  
&gXL{cK'%  
89&9VX^A  
e.g. He looked up and nodded to me. }+KM"+@$<  
look up to:尊敬 s9wzN6re  
e.g. It must be rewarding to be looked up to by so many people. mKe6rEUs|  
41) make one’s way:开路 cj2Smgw&>  
e.g. As soon as he saw us the teacher made his way through the crowd to greet us. mw5>[  
make one’s way to:向……走去 &s`)_P[  
e.g. In the evening we made our way to the appointed meeting place. _;PQt" ]  
42)measure to:测量到某一精度 }'P|A  
e.g. Measure this part to mm. measure |Gz<I  
up to:够得上,可以匹敌 7I[[S!((s  
e.g. The new techniques measure up to advanced world standard. jI8`trD  
43)more than:很,非常 P;I,f  
e.g. He was more than upset by the accident. 5>9Q<*   
more…than:比……更 O<s7VHj  
e.g. I regarded her more highly than me. R9A:"sJ  
44) much as:虽然 mHMsK}=~  
e.g. Much as I should like to go I can’t go right now. HMUx/M.j  
as much:同样的或同样多少的 VzSkqWF/"  
e.g. You have always helped me and I will always do as much for you. 9mD dX  
45) no less than:不亚于,竟达……之多 V Dnrm*  
e.g. There were no less than one hundred people at the meeting. OG<*&V  
not less than:不比……差,至少 \ *CXXp`  
)$^xbC#j`3  
e.g. There were not less than one hundred people at the meeting. -`q!mdA2  
请大家注意区分以上两句的差别,第一句是指“竟达100 人之多”,第二句则是“至少有100 人”,要 l)$mpMgAD  
明白no less than 是一种强调说法,它和not less than 的区别在于事先假定的程度或是数量有所不同,no h's[) t  
less than 在某种意义上说来没有超过的意思,而not less than 可能会超过,这种表达方式正好与no more rrU(>jA!  
than 以及not more than 相反。 On);SN'  
46) no more than:同样不;仅仅,只有 "-S!^h/v  
e.g. This book is no more interesting than that one. It is no more than empty talk. =&pR=vl  
not more than:不比……更,不如;至多 w31O~Ve  
e.g. He is not more clever than you are. There were not more than 5 factories in our city before liberation. :gRrM)n  
47)on sale:出售的;廉价出售 A&1EOQ=N  
e.g. Many new farm tools are on sale in this store. I got this book on sale it was very cheap. a)2l9  
for sale:出售的,上市的 Y_*KAr'{P  
e.g. I shall put these goods up for sale. S3x^#83  
在作“出售的”的意思的时候,on sale 和for sale 还是有一些不同的,一般来说,for sale 多指物主亲 aEdMZ+P.  
自或委托代理人经手出售,而on sale 通常表示店里的货物是供出售的。 ^'Lp<YJs6  
48)once again:再一次 rIPg,4y*S!  
e.g. I want to try this once again. qX5]\nX&G  
once and again:一再 W\<OCD%X  
e.g. I have told him once and again not to do that. Onqapm0  
49) out of question:毫无疑问,必定 GX19GI@k  
e.g. Out of question this plan can be fulfilled ahead of time. j*8Ze!^  
out of the question:不可能的 J-=fy^S5  
e.g. What you propose is out of the question. @I Y<i5(  
50)refer to:提及,涉及 :Dr4?6hdr  
e.g. I would like to refer back to the first of my three points. + ,]&&  
DDIRJd<J  
refer to…as:称作,叫做 Nc6y]eGz  
e.g. Coal is often referred to as food for industry. fc:87ZR{K  
51)search sb.:认真搜查某人身体 L9hL@  
e.g. They searched him but nothing was found on him. ,f>^ q"  
search for sb.:搜查某地为找到某人 3mE8tTA$R  
e.g. They searched for him everywhere but failed. r_ 9"^Er  
52)settle down:落下;定居 5FJ%"5n&  
e.g. The dust slowly settled down. He has settled down in the countryside. \py&v5J)s!  
settle down to:专心致力于;逐渐习惯于 ]%7m+-h@  
e.g. He settled down to his homework. They settled down to a new job. 8f?o?c|  
53)speak for itself:不言而喻 z xv y&  
e.g. One does not to be told that this fact speaks for itself. pOy(XUV9O  
speak for oneself:发表本人的意见 %RIu'JXi  
e.g. What others think I do not know I can only speak for myself. '6WZi|(a  
54)submit to:屈服于 qyE*?73W  
e.g. He has to submit to an operation. ciH TnC  
submit…to:提交 cw BiT  
e.g. They must submit the case to the court. ]~m=b` o
